Hi Audioguyjosh,

Now my system is fully working in El capitan, iMessage, FaceTime, sleep all are working. And looks to be stable.

Ethernet I have to use an Intel 82574 ethernet card, with Nullethernet.kext from RehabMan.

Sleep function needs to disable deep sleep, but I can't tell the different between deep sleep and normal sleep. the Hac seems totally shutdown,fans also shut down. and wake up pretty fast. So I'm happy with it. I disable deep sleep according to ammulder's "Big list of solution for El Capitan Problems", which is a terminal code "sudo pmset -a standby 0 && sudo pmset -a autopoweroff 0".
